- The distance between Sydney, New South Wales, Australia and San Cristobal, Dominican Republic is approximately 15,600 km or 9,694 mi.
- To reach Sydney, New South Wales in this distance one would set out from San Cristobal bearing 238.8°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Sydney, New South Wales bearing 282.2° or WNW .
- Sydney, New South Wales has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as San Cristobal has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am).
- The mean temperature is 7.8 °C (14.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.9 °C (12.4°F) more in Sydney, New South Wales.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 297.3 mm (11.7 in) less which is equivalent to 297.3 l/m² (7.3 US gal/ft²) or 2,973,000 l/ha (317,833 US gal/ac) less. About 4/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 14.6° lower in Sydney, New South Wales than in San Cristobal.
- Relative humidity levels are 15%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 10.9°C (19.7°F) lower.
